Benefits of Civil Engineering Internships

Civil engineering internships offer a wide range of benefits to participants, contributing significantly to their personal and professional growth. Here are some key advantages of undertaking a civil engineering internship:

  • Hands-on experience: Internships provide the opportunity to work on real-world engineering projects, allowing interns to apply their theoretical knowledge and develop practical skills. This experience enhances critical thinking, problem-solving, and decision-making abilities.
  • Exposure to different disciplines: Internships expose participants to various aspects of civil engineering, including structural, geotechnical, transportation, and environmental engineering. This exposure helps interns explore different areas of the field and make informed decisions about their career paths.
  • Networking opportunities: Internships offer chances to connect with professionals in the industry, building valuable relationships and expanding one’s professional network. These connections can lead to future job opportunities and provide mentorship and guidance.
  • Enhanced practical skills and technical knowledge: Civil engineering internships provide a platform for interns to develop and enhance their practical skills and technical knowledge. 
  • Potential for future job opportunities: Internships often serve as a pathway to future employment. Many companies use internships as a recruitment tool to identify talented individuals for full-time positions. 

Factors to Consider when Choosing an Internship

When selecting a civil engineering internship, it’s important to consider several factors to ensure that it aligns with your goals and provides a valuable learning experience. Here are some key factors to consider when choosing an internship:

  • Relevance to career goals and interests: Look for internships that align with your specific career goals and interests within civil engineering. Consider the type of projects, disciplines, and sectors the internship focuses on. 
  • Reputation and credibility of the company/organization: Research and assess the reputation and credibility of the company or organization offering the internship. Look for well-established firms, renowned engineering companies, or government agencies with a strong track record in the industry. 
  • Project variety and complexity: Consider the variety and complexity of the projects interns will be involved in during the internship. Aim for internships that offer a diverse range of projects, allowing you to gain exposure to different aspects of civil engineering.
  • Mentorship and learning opportunities: Evaluate the mentorship and learning opportunities provided during the internship. Look for internships that offer guidance and support from experienced professionals who can mentor you throughout the program. 
  • Geographical location and potential relocation: Consider the geographical location of the internship and whether you are open to relocating for the duration of the program. Some internships may be local, allowing you to stay in your current area, while others may require you to move to a different city or even country.

1. Jacobs Engineering Group

Jacobs Engineering Group is a prominent global engineering firm known for its comprehensive range of services in the field of civil engineering. Their internship program offers students a chance to work alongside seasoned professionals on diverse projects across sectors such as transportation, water resources, environmental engineering, and infrastructure development. 

The program typically spans 10-12 weeks and provides interns with hands-on experience in areas like design, project management, and construction supervision. Jacobs Engineering Group emphasizes mentorship and provides interns with guidance from experienced engineers, fostering their professional growth. 

Past interns have praised the company’s commitment to sustainable practices, the opportunity to contribute to impactful projects and the extensive networking opportunities within the organization.

2. AECOM

AECOM is a leading multinational engineering firm renowned for its expertise in designing and delivering complex infrastructure projects. Their internship program offers students a chance to gain practical experience in a variety of disciplines, including civil, structural, transportation, and environmental engineering. 

The program duration varies, ranging from 10-16 weeks, depending on the specific internship role. Interns at AECOM are exposed to real-world projects, collaborating with multidisciplinary teams to solve engineering challenges. 

The company provides mentorship, ensuring interns receive guidance and support from experienced professionals throughout their internships. Interns at AECOM have highlighted the company’s commitment to sustainability, the opportunity to work on iconic projects, and the potential for long-term career prospects.

3. Arup

Arup is a renowned global engineering and consulting firm known for its innovative and sustainable approach to engineering design. Their internship program offers students the opportunity to work on cutting-edge projects in various fields, including structural engineering, transportation planning, and sustainable design. 

The program typically lasts for 8-12 weeks and allows interns to collaborate with industry experts, gaining practical experience in their chosen discipline. Arup emphasizes a hands-on approach, allowing interns to actively contribute to project deliverables while receiving guidance and mentorship from senior engineers. 

Previous interns have praised Arup for its commitment to pushing the boundaries of engineering, the exposure to a wide range of projects, and the inclusive and collaborative work culture within the organization.

4. Turner Construction Company

Turner Construction Company is a renowned global construction services company with expertise in a wide range of civil engineering projects. Their internship program offers students the opportunity to gain hands-on experience in various aspects of construction management. 

The program typically lasts for 12 weeks and exposes interns to different phases of construction projects, including planning, scheduling, estimating, and field operations. Interns at Turner Construction Company work alongside experienced professionals, participating in project meetings, site visits, and documentation processes. 

The company emphasizes mentorship and provides interns with guidance and support to enhance their skills and knowledge in construction engineering. Turner Construction Company is known for its commitment to safety, innovation, and delivering high-quality projects, making it an excellent choice for those interested in the construction side of civil engineering.

5. HDR Engineering, Inc.

HDR Engineering, Inc. is a leading global engineering firm specializing in consulting, design, and construction services for various infrastructure projects. Their internship program offers students the opportunity to work on a wide range of civil engineering projects, including transportation, water resources, environmental, and energy. 

The program duration varies depending on the specific internship role and project requirements. Interns at HDR Engineering, Inc. work closely with industry professionals, gaining practical experience in areas such as engineering design, data analysis, and project coordination. The company focuses on providing interns with challenging assignments that contribute to real-world projects, fostering their professional growth. 

HDR Engineering, Inc. is known for its commitment to sustainability, technological innovation, and delivering solutions that positively impact communities, making it an ideal choice for interns interested in making a difference through their engineering work.

Application Process and Tips

Securing a civil engineering internship requires a well-prepared application that highlights your skills, experiences, and passion for the field. Here are some essential steps and tips to help you navigate the application process successfully:

  • Research and identify target companies: Begin by researching and identifying companies or organizations that align with your career goals and interests in civil engineering. Explore their internship programs, project portfolios, and company culture to ensure a good fit.
  • Prepare a tailored resume and cover letter: Customize your resume and cover letter to showcase relevant coursework, projects, and experiences. Highlight any technical skills, software proficiency, and certifications you possess. Emphasize your academic achievements and extracurricular involvement that demonstrate your passion for civil engineering.
  • Gather strong references: Obtain references from professors, advisors, or professionals who can vouch for your skills and work ethic. Choose individuals who are familiar with your academic or professional abilities and can speak positively about your potential as a civil engineer.
  • Submit a polished application package: Ensure that all application materials, including your resume, cover letter, personal statement, and any additional documents, are error-free, well-structured, and professional in appearance. Double-check for typos, grammar mistakes, and formatting issues before submitting.
  • Network and seek guidance: Connect with professionals, professors, and career counselors who can provide insights into the industry and offer guidance during the application process. Attend career fairs, industry events, or virtual networking sessions to expand your professional network and gain valuable advice.
